Healthcare Georgia Foundation Announces Addition of Two New Board Members

Anita Barkin and Robert S. Wynn were confirmed to the Healthcare Georgia Foundation Board on March 30, 2020 during the Foundation’s quarterly Board meeting

Atlanta, GA – April 8, 2020 – Healthcare Georgia Foundation has announced the addition of Anita Barkin, MSN, DrPH, NP-C and Robert S. Wynn, CFA to its Board effective March 30, 2020.

Barkin formerly served as Acting Deputy Director/District Nursing Director for the North Central Health District, and received the Lillian E. Wald award by the Georgia Public Health Association in 2018 for her contributions to nursing practice. Prior to moving to Georgia, Barkin also served as the Director of Carnegie Mellon University Health Services for over 25 years.

Wynn joins the Foundation Board as the Founder and President of Wynn Capital. Prior to founding Wynn Capital, Rob served clients as a Global Investment Specialist with the J.P. Morgan Private Bank in Atlanta and as a Portfolio Manager at Asset Advisors Corporation in Augusta, Georgia. Wynn also served in the United States Navy as a Submarine Warfare Officer aboard the submarines USS HONOLULU and USS MICHIGAN based in Honolulu, Hawaii and Bremerton, Washington.

About Healthcare Georgia Foundation
Healthcare Georgia Foundation is a statewide, charitable organization with a vision of health equity in Georgia where all people attain their fullest potential for health and well-being.
